The laboratory testing services which we can provide are:
Test on Soil Samples
Grain Size Analysis & Hydrometer
Moisture Content and Density
Void Ratio
Atterberg Limits & Shrinkage Limit
Specific Gravity
Relative density
Swell Index
Swelling Pressure- oedometer and constant volume methods
Direct Shear Tests
Direct shear test on remoulded specimen
Permeability (Falling head and Constant head)
Unconfined Compression (UCS)
Unconsolidated undrained (UU Triaxial)
Consolidated Undrained (CU triaxial) with pore pressure measurement
Consolidated Drained (CD triaxial) with volume change measurement
Standard and Modified Compaction Tests
California Bearing Ratio (CBR)
Field CBR tests
Plate Load Test
One- dimensional Consolidation up to 16 bars
Test on Rocks:
Density dry / saturated
Moisture Content
Water absorption
Specific Gravity
Porosity
Unconfined Compressive Strength
Point Load Strength
Triaxial Compression
Modulus of Elasticity
Poisson's Ratio
Brazilian Test
Slake Durability
Joint Shear Test
Cerchar Abrasion test (CAR)
Lugeon tests (Water pressure tests)
In-situ Field Tests:
Standard Penetration Test (SPT)
Dynamic Cone Penetration Test (DCPT)
SPT for road construction
Field permeability tests (constant and falling head)
